The trippy twist stretching throughout your display screen is a doctored flower—although you gained’t see this creation at a marriage reception anytime quickly.

Every spiral is a product of an enhancing approach referred to as slit-scan pictures. On this documentation technique, a photographer takes a video or string of back-to-back photos as a scene rushes by. Then they reduce a slim strip out of the identical place in every {photograph} or filmed scene and stack the slits in sequential order. The collage reveals how a particular, slim point of interest recorded one thing totally different in every successive picture. Since its early days of serving to to find out which horse crossed a end line first, the approach has advanced to incorporate purposes similar to documenting all of the objects that roll down a high-speed manufacturing facility conveyor belt (line scan cameras) and making a distorted selfie utilizing the Time Warp Scan filter in TikTok.

In these examples, photographers Ted Kinsman and David Parker traded operating horses for video stills of a spinning flower. When horizontal slices of every flower picture, captured because the flower spun stem-side down, had been assembled and turned sideways, the composite resembled a twirly rope. “I personally discover these photos new and thrilling to make,” Kinsman wrote in a submit on the Rochester Institute of Know-how’s Pictures Weblog in 2017. “Even after making these photos for 20 years, I still never quite know what to expect.”
